Output ab6160622957aa2ae6c52d331a765ecb177b4605acb8bb2c22c9f898cc0d7f02:0

value
7546904
script pubkey
OP_0 OP_PUSHBYTES_20 18b6eafb9993285292e56b07c3c0cb2ebc2b8f3c
address
bc1qrzmw47uejv599yh9dvru8sxt967zhreucq3xhy
transaction
ab6160622957aa2ae6c52d331a765ecb177b4605acb8bb2c22c9f898cc0d7f02
confirmations
134625
spent
true